You know KAPOS used to be just one competition. the maximum # was 16 and everybody competed in the same division. well they still had traditional and 2 1/2 minute but they didn't break it down into small, medium and Large. But the only problem with that were small schools who couldn't put 16 girls on the mat or very large schools that had 25-30 girls on the squad. So this is actually better and more fair based on the size of the school and the squad. and really when they are scored everyone has the same advantage based on how many members are on the mat. Small- 3 stunt groups- Medium 4-stunt groups Large- 5 stunt groups. But they is no rule that says a squad beased on school size has to compete in any certain division. so you can compete small if you think it's more of an advantage but of course, we all know based on region, that didn't happen.

Cant do it. Since cheerleading isnt considered a sanctioned sport by the KHSAA they cant enforce those kinds of rules.
They wouldnt do it anyway. They dont force dance teams to compete like that, swim teams can pick whatever event they want to compete in, track members can run whatever event they want, and other sports where there are multiple divisions or events.
If they did make it so a certain school had to compete in a certain division, they would have to say "well this school has to go traditional, and this school has to go 2 1/2 min." Also, it IS a matter of participation. Some smaller schools might have a large interest in cheerleading while larger schools dont have as much interest if any at all.
